ABOUT THE TEAM
The Anduril AIRS team specializes in high-performance cooled infrared imaging solutions, including IDCAs, modules, and cameras. We leverage state-of-the-art technologies, innovative designs, and vertically integrated manufacturing processes to meet the unique, mission-critical imaging needs of system integrators and instrumentation manufacturers facing complex thermal challenges.
